Air Force Sharpshooters Watch Over Troops in IraqBy Staff Sgt. Markus M. Maier, USAF Special to American Forces Press Service
KIRKUK REGIONAL AIR BASE, Iraq, Nov. 19, 2007 When servicemembers here have to go “outside the wire,” they sometimes have an extra set of eyes watching over them.

Air Force Staff Sgt. Curtis Huffman and Airman 1st Class Matt Sleeper, deployed to Kirkuk Air Base, Iraq, from the 354th Security Forces Squadron at Eielson Air Force Base, Alaska, as members of the 506th Expeditionary Security Forces Squadron Close Precision Engagement Team, set up surveillance on top of a lookout point, Nov. 13, 2007.
